Technical Architect- Backend
Location
Chennai | India
Job description
Company: Indian / Global Digital Organization
Key Skills: Architect, Java, System Design, Scalability, API
Roles and Responsibilities:
- Lead and mentor teams in delivering scalable, low-latency architecture and cost-effective solutions across various product teams.
- Identify areas of improvement within the existing codebase and implement corrective measures.
- Utilize various open-source distributed systems to implement solutions and deliver fully-fledged products.
- Ensure timely execution of solutions to address gaps and technical debt.
- Spearhead the development of novel solutions from scratch, collaborating with architects and engineers from other product teams to promote these solutions.
- Conduct regular code and architectural reviews, providing timely feedback to maintain code clarity, streamline complexities, and advocate best practices.
- Stay abreast of technological advancements and explore ways to leverage them to enhance product delivery and quality.
- Assist the team in identifying and executing features with the right trade-offs, ensuring quality and timely delivery.
- Develop cohesive development strategies across the organization.
Skills Required:
- Proficiency in JavaScript, Java, C++, or other programming languages.
- A minimum of 7+ years of relevant work experience in a product or startup environment.
- Strong expertise in designing for scalability and performance.
- Capability to conduct peer code reviews.
- Strong problem-solving skills.
- Expertise in data structures and algorithms.
Education: Bachelor's Degree in related field
Job tags
Salary